Analysis

Kuwait recorded 3,850 for level of water stress: freshwater withdrawal as a proportion of in 2022. That is the highest value across all 30 years on record.

That represents a change of up 24.5% over ten years.

Over the whole period, level of water stress: freshwater withdrawal as a proportion of in Kuwait peaked at 3,850 in 2017 and was at its lowest, 1,295, in 1994.

That places Kuwait 1st out of 178 countries with data for 2022, putting it in the top 10%.

The long-run direction has been consistently rising across the 30 years of available data.

The level of water stress: freshwater withdrawal as a proportion of available freshwater resources is the ratio between total freshwater withdrawn by all major sectors and total renewable freshwater resources, after taking into account environmental water requirements. Main sectors, as defined by ISIC standards, include agriculture; forestry and fishing; manufacturing; electricity industry; and services. This indicator is also known as water withdrawal intensity.
